“…Singha and Bhowmik [4] report a detailed review of databases and MODA for night scenarios. An analysis of tendencies of MODA, to identify the main techniques like; basic, learning dictionaries, statistical, neural networks, fuzzy logic, subspaces, robust tensors, domain transformation, is presented in a recent paper [5]. The work also evaluates the limitations of each technique and the trends regarding databases, hardware, programming language, and processing time.…”
